C/C++及其相关
-
C/C++程序设计教程陈策等编著本书是系统介绍C与C++语言的基础教程。全书共分12课,第1课到第6课主要讲解C语言程序设计的内容,包括C语言的发展历史、C程序的特点与基本构成、C中的数据类型、运算符和表达式、程序控制语句、函数和预编译指令等。从第7课开始,主要讲解C++语言在面向对象方面扩充的内容和特性,包括面向对象方法学的基本理论、C++程序的基本构成、类与对象、函数与运算符重载、继承与多态等。第12课专门对C与C++中的输入与输出功能进行了讲解和对比。每课除了讲解C与C++必备的知识外,还有上机操作部分、常见问题解答和课后作业,以帮助读者更好地理解和掌握本单元的内容。书中的源代码和习题答案均可在http://www.cmpbook.com免费下载。本书内容全面、实例丰富、叙述清晰、结构安排合理,既能作为学习C与C++语言的入门书籍,又能作为深入掌握C与C++的提高书籍。本书适合电脑培训班学员及C/C++编程爱好者使用。 -
VISUAL BASIC简明教程马力主编本书是Visual Basic 的入门教材,是以Visual Basic 6.0为背景进行讲述的。内容包括三大部分:Visual Basic的程序设计、用户界面设计和Visual Basic的高级应用。本书用和循序渐进的方式对Visual Basic 的基本知识进行了详细的介绍,为初学者提供了简明易懂的参考。同时,Visual Basic 6.0编程的提高部分在本书也有一定的涉及,如在数据库应用部分主要介绍Visual Basic 6.0新增添的ADO对象,加入了创建ActiveX控件的内容。本书内容丰富,重点突出,层次清晰。书中精选了大有代表性的实例,每章后附有习题,帮助读者进一步掌握和巩固所学的内容。书后还附有上机实验的题目和要求,供读者学习。本书可作为高职高专及中等职业学校计算机应用专业的教材使用,也可作为相应院校非计算机专业和计算机培训班教材,及计算机应用人员的参考书。 -
C++习题与实训叶青松本书根据教育部《职业院校计算机应用和软件专业领域技能型紧缺人才培养培训指导方案》编写。本书是《程序语言C++及开发应用》配套的习题与实训指导。内容包括教材中各章的习题与实训题。主要包括引入面向对象方法(C++概述),创建对象(C++简单程序设计),封装与抽象,运算符与判定结构,对象的生命周期(构造函数和析构函数),指针及其应用,多态性,继承与派生,流类库与输入/输出,群体类与算法初步,异常处理等。本书需与主教材配套使用,适合作为高等职院校教材。 -
C++习题与解答李代平,张伯泉编著本书配合《C++程序设计教程》的内容,介绍了数据类型与表达式、控制结构、函数、数组、指针、结构体与共用体、类和对象、继承和派生类、多态、类属机制、C++的输入/输出流库和异常处理竺内容,并就各章节知识点给出了综合练习,还给出了相关练习的参考答案。本书可以作为大专院校相关专业学生的参考用书,特别刊登计算机相科和专科的学生、报考计算机硕土研究生的考生、参加国家门徒教育自学考试的考生、参加计算机等级考试的考生以及计算机专业计算机专业的高级人员参考。本书每章包括的三个题型(选择题、填空题、编程题)是与《C++程序设计教程》相对应的。选择题、填空题考察读者的基本知识,对选择题给出了必要的分析,力求对每个知识点都讲解清楚,使读者对该知识点的来龙去脉有较深刻的理解;填空题进一步巩固基本知识点;编程题考察读者的综合知识的运用能力,对每道编程题都给出了参考答案,这些参考答案都能够在VisualC++编译器上编译成功,具有参考性和启发性,读者也可参考答案另行编程。通过本书的学习,读者能够较全面的掌握C++语言的相关知识,并能较快地提高自己的编程水平。 -
C++并行与分布式编程(美)Cameron Hughes,(美)Tracey Hughes著;肖和平,张杰良等译;肖和平译本书以作者成功的软件设计和实现的经验系统地论述了使用C++语言进行并行与分布式编程的技术,对并行与分布式编程中固有的问题提出了多种解决方案。本书的主要内容有:并发编程的乐趣;并行和分布式编程的挑战;将C++程序分成多个任务;将C++程序分成多个线程;任务间并发的同步;通过PVM为C++增加并行编程能力;错误处理、异常和软件可靠性;C++分布式面向对象编程;MPI与使用模板的SPMD和MPMD模型;可视化并发和分布式系统设计;设计支持并发的组件;实现面向agent的体系结构;使用PVM、线程和C++组件的黑板体系结构。除此之外,本书还提供了包含Pthread线程库的新POSIX/UNIX IEEE标准,可供编程人员参考。本书适合于计算机编程人员、软件开发人员、设计人员、研究人员和软件设计师阅读,也可作为希望使用C++进行并行与分布式软件开发的计算机专业学生的入门教材。 -
C语言大学实用教程苏小红等编著本书是一本充满趣味性和实用性的大学C语言教材,适合作为大学各专业公共课教材和全国计算机等级考试参考书。全书由11章组成,内容包括:程序设计ABC,数据类型、运算符与表达式,简单的C程序设计,程序的控制结构,函数,数组,指针,结构体与共用体,函数的高级应用,文件操作,C程序设计常见错误及解决方案等。本书注重教材的可读性和可用性,每章开头有内容关键词和难点提示;典型例题一题多解,由浅入深,强化知识点、算法、编程方法与技巧;还将程序测试、程序调试与排错、软件的健壮性和代码风格、结构化与模块化程序设计方法等软件工程知识融入其中;配套提供题型丰富的《C语言大学实用教程习题与实验指导》教材;本书还将为任课教师免费提供电子课件,其中包括全部例题和习题源程序文件(可按前言提供的方式索取)。目录第1章程序设计ABC1.1计算机与人1.2计算机与程序设计语言1.3程序设计语言的故事1.4程序设计语言的工作原理1.4.1运行1.4.2内存1.5本章小结习题1第2章数据类型、运算符与表达式2.1一个简单的C程序例子2.2C程序常见标识符号分类2.3数据类型2.3.1为什么引入数据类型2.3.2从基本数据类型到抽象数据类型2.3.3类型修饰符2.3.4标识符命名2.4常量2.4.1整型常量2.4.2实型常量2.4.3字符常量2.4.4字符串常量2.4.5宏常量2.4.6枚举常量2.5变量2.5.1变量的声明与初始化2.5.2const类型修饰符2.5.3使用变量时的注意事项2.6常用运算符及表达式2.6.1运算符的优先级与结合性2.6.2算术运算符2.6.3关系运算符2.6.4逻辑运算符...... -
C语言程序设计习题解答与上机指导林小茶 编著《C语言程序设计习题解答与上机指导》是中国铁道出版社出版的教材《C语语程序设计》的配套教材,也适合单独作为学习C语言的学习辅导书。《C语言程序设计习题解答与上机指导》给出了教材《C语言程序设计》中所有大约200道习题的参考答案,并编写了九个实验,每个实验包括实验目的和要求以及实验内容等,供广大教师和学生参考。同时,为了方便大家的上机,还编写了上机指南,对Turbo C集成环境做了较为详细的介绍。书中内容分为三部分,第一部分是“《C语言程序设计》习题解答”,这部分内容对教材中的每道习题都给出了详细的解答,有些习题还给出了不同的解题方法,这些习题是作者多年以来在教学中积累、收集并经过验证的习题,全部经过上机调试通过;第二部分“C语言上机指导”介绍了程序设计实验的一般步骤,并给出了一份上机报告详例,并精心设计了九套上机实验题,每套实验都给出了实验目的,要求和内容,帮助读者在实验中巩固所学知识;第一部分“C语言上机指南”介绍了Turbo C集成环境中的常用命令的使用方法。 -
嵌入式系统的微模块化程序设计(美)Miro Samek著;敬万钧,陈丽蓉译;敬万钧译建模反应式系统而不使用重量级的工具,作者的量子编程(QP)是一种新的范型。它把状态图作为一种设计方法,而不是作为特殊工具来使用。在本书的第1部分,给出相关概念清晰而明确的叙述,包括传统的有限状态机和状态图,以及基于状态图的设计模式;给出了可运行代码,使读者能通过实际操作来学习量子编程,以及学到状态嵌套如何导致行为继承和如何通过按差异编程而实现重用。第2部分完整地叙述了量子框架的实现,以及说明如何在应用中使用它,并移植到所选用的RTOS。本书适于嵌入式系统、实时系统及UML状态图的相关工程设计人员使用,并可作计算机科学和电气工程高年级学生的教学用书。所附光盘包含了作者的量子框架的全部源代码、散见于全书的所有练习的答案以及一个RTOS32的评估板——X86处理器的32位实时操作系统。 -
C++程序设计课程设计刘振安,刘燕君,孙枕编著本书特点:·独立于具体的C++语言教科书,重点放在C++语言的基本特征上。·结合实际应用,训练学生实际分析问题,解决问题及编程的能力,并养成良好的编程习惯。·通过详细的实例,循序渐进地启发学生完成设计。·对同一类型的实验,提供不同的实现方法,以满足不同学校和学生的要求。·提供综合课程设计,进一步锻炼学生使用面向对象方法思考问题及动手的能力。课程设计可以充分弥补课堂教学和实验中知识深度和广度有限的问题,更好地帮助学生系统地掌握该门课程的主要内容。本书是一本独立于具体的C++语言教科书的课程设计辅导,重点放在C++语言的基本特征上,结合实际应用,通过详细的实例,循序渐进地启发学生完成设计。书中给出的实例都很完整,并给出了测试样例,是一本很好的教学辅导参考书。 -
C语言程序设计教程朱承学主编C语言作为一种结构化的计算机程序设计语言,既具有高级语言的特点,又具有低级语言的功能,在当今软件开发领域有着十分广泛的应用。本书通过循序渐进地解析程序代码,阐明C语言结构的语法和正确使用,系统地讲述了c语言程序设计的基本方法和技巧,并揭示出其应用的基础逻辑。全书选材经典,内容丰富,阐述清晰,层次分明。讲述力求理论联系实际、循序渐进,注重培养读者分析问题和程序设计的能力,注重培养良好的程序设计风格和习惯。本书的主要内容包括:C语言的基本语法和概念、数据类型及应用技巧、C语言模块化程序设计的方法、文件的基本概念和应用以及综合程序设计基础。为了配合本书的学习及适应程序设计课程教学的三个环节,作者还编写了与本书配套的《C语言程序设计实验指导与习题解析》及《C语言程序设计实践训练教程》,可供读者参考使用。本书可作为高等院校计算机程序设计教学用书,也可作为从事计算机应用的科技人员的参考书和培训教材。本书配有CAI教学课件,可到中国水利水电出版社网站(http://www.waterpub.com.cn)下载。
